Add S349-f, Gen Bus L
 
Prohibits the selling, offering for sale or distribution of any electrical or extension cords with fraudulent seals for the Underwriters' Laboratory; authorizes local code enforcement entities to enforce the provisions of the section; provides that for the first civil penalty of this section, a one hundred dollar fine shall be issued and such seller or distributor shall complete a training seminar on how to identify false Underwriters' Laboratory labels and increases fines for the second or subsequent violations of this section; provides that a training component shall be created and provided by the office of fire prevention and control and shall be made available on its website.

        AN ACT to amend the general business law, in relation  to  the  selling,
          offering for sale or distribution of any electrical or extension cords
          with a fraudulent seal for the Underwriters' Laboratory
 
          The  People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and Assem-
        bly, do enact as follows:
 
     1    Section 1. The general business law is amended by adding a new section
     2  349-f to read as follows:
     3    § 349-f. Selling of fraudulent electrical or extension cords. 1.    No
     4  merchant,  manufacturer,  firm,  corporation,  association  or  agent or
     5  employee thereof shall knowingly sell, offer for sale or  distribute  in
     6  this  state any electrical cord or extension cord with a fraudulent seal
     7  for the Underwriters' Laboratory. For the purposes of this section,  the

     8  term  "merchant" shall mean a person, firm or corporation engaged in the
     9  sale, display or offering for sale of consumer products  or  merchandise
    10  at an established retail store to a consumer.
    11    2.  Every  merchant,  manufacturer,  firm,  corporation or association
    12  shall be responsible for the training and education of its employees  to
    13  learn  the  difference  between certified Underwriters' Laboratory elec-
    14  trical or extension cords and fraudulent or  counterfeit  electrical  or
    15  extension cords.
    16    3.  The  provisions  of  this  section shall not be deemed to alter or
    17  otherwise supersede any other labeling or disclosure requirement imposed
    18  by state or federal law.

    19    4. Enforcement shall be provided by the local government code enforce-
    20  ment entity.

     1    5. The civil penalty for a violation of this section shall be  a  fine
     2  up to one hundred dollars and the seller or distributor shall complete a
     3  training  seminar  on  how  to  identify  false Underwriters' Laboratory
     4  labels. For the second or subsequent violations  of  this  section,  the
     5  fine  shall  be  up  to  five hundred dollars. Each sale of a fraudulent

     6  electrical or extension cord in violation of this section shall  consti-
     7  tute a separate violation.
     8    6. A training component shall be created and provided by the office of
     9  fire  prevention and control and shall be made available on its website.
    10  Any person found selling electrical products  with  false  Underwriters'
    11  Laboratory labels shall take an on-line course.
    12    § 2. This act shall take effect on the one hundred twentieth day after
    13  it shall have become a law.
